The bill entitled an Act to require the Clerk of the Circuit
Court for Washington county to prepare and make a general
index to the land records of Washington county, and to
transcribe one of the Equity dockets of said Court,

Was read a second time and ordered to be engrossed for a
third reading.

The bill entitled an Act for the protection, of wild game
within the limits of Frederick county, was taken up for con-
sideration, said bill being upon a second reading, when,
On motion of Mr. Herbert,

It was ordered to he printed.

The bill entitled an Act to amend an Act entitled an Act
to authorize and empower the County Commissioners of Kent
county to subscribe, in behalf of said county, to the capital
stock of the Kent County Rail Road Company, and to issue
bonds for the same and to provide for their redemption,
passed at January session, eighteen hundred and sixty-seven,
chapter 139, by adding a proviso to the first section of said
Act, relating to the issuing of county bonds and the time
for their payment,

Was read a third time and passed by yeas and nays as
follows :
